Job Summary Description / Primary Purpose Of Job
This position is responsible for documenting and performing verification tests for hearing aids, accessories, manufacturing software, fitting software, mobile applications, programmers, their components, and sub-systems. Responsible for assisting in problem solving and issue resolution. The primary responsible is to verify new products; however, may also be responsible for supporting continuation engineering and technology development, as needed.
Job Responsibilities/Results
Document, and continuously improve the system verification tests
- Document and conduct peer review of test procedures to comply with System Requirements assigned for verification
- Document and conduct peer review of test procedures to ensure coverage of defined use cases
- Continuously improve existing test procedures to address previously identified test gaps as captured during test execution in JIRA and lessons learned on a program basis
- Conduct system verification tests as assigned following the defined test procedures
- Document the configuration under test and the test results within existing tools
- Ensure complete verification of the system requirements traced to the test procedure is achieved
- Conduct a peer review of the test results, if needed, and drive to resolution of the action items
- Report any test procedure gaps in JIRA
- Clearly present results of assigned test procedures
- Perform Alpha/Pilot device preparation as per the defined checklist
- Provide support to Systems Design/Verification Engineers during Alpha/Pilot and Beta studies
- Provide support to Systems Design/Verification Engineers during product ramp-up
- Provide support to Systems Design/Verification Engineers in resolving issues pertaining to existing products
- Document technical issues identified during system verification with clear description of steps to reproduce and configuration under test in relevant tools
- Provide regular updates on issues assigned in relevant tools
- Review the document thoroughly in preparation for review meeting
- Provide clear and concise feedback in a timely manner considering test gaps
- Clean and organize lab environment
- Keep track of the calibration methods, requirements, and due dates
- Support parts and equipment purchases
- Support process improvements and lean product development efforts
- Provide efficient, systematic, and well documented feedback for the assigned tasks
Education
- Minimum 2-year Electronic Technician degree/certificate or equivalent is required.
- Minimum 7 years’ experience in electronic design, test, and manufacturing.
- Minimum 1 years’ experience in a regulated environment (medical or military).
- Experience desired in hearing instrument and accessory design, development, and test.
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of microelectronic circuits and components required
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of common business software required (i.e. Microsoft Office suite)
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of product development processes for microelectronic circuits required
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of bench top test instrumentation control and use
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of verification methodologies
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of software development methodologies
- Intermediate to advanced knowledge of ANSI, IEC, and homologation standards desirable
- Excellent design, problem solving, and documentation skills required
- Excellent attention to detail required
- Good verbal and written communication skills required
- Good organizational skills required
- Must be self-motivated and able to work in a fast-paced environment
